GNU bug report logs - #36374
‘guix pull’ should not suggest running ‘guix pull’

Previous Next

Package: guix;

Reported by: Ludovic Courtès <ludo <at> gnu.org>

Date: Tue, 25 Jun 2019 14:09:02 UTC

Severity: important

Full log


Message #8 received at submit <at> debbugs.gnu.org (full text, mbox):

From: Julien Lepiller <julien <at> lepiller.eu>
To: bug-guix <at> gnu.org,Ludovic Courtès <ludo <at> gnu.org>
Subject: Re: bug#36374: ‘guix pull’ should not suggest running ‘guix pull’
Date: Wed, 26 Jun 2019 16:19:26 +0200
[Message part 1 (text/plain, inline)]
Le 25 juin 2019 16:08:19 GMT+02:00, "Ludovic Courtès" <ludo <at> gnu.org> a écrit :
>The article at
><https://distrowatch.com/weekly.php?issue=20190624#guixsd> has a
>screenshot showing ‘guix pull’ suggesting to run ‘guix pull && guix
>package -u’.  This is obviously wrong.
>
>Ludo’.

Here is a patch to address this issue on Guix System. It creates new files in /etc/skel: an initial profile (.config/guix/initial) tgat only contains a symlink to /run/current-system/profile/bin/guix and the current profile as a symlink to the initial profile.

At first boot, and for new users, guix well be found in the current profile, and stays there after guix pull, so we don't need to use hash guix anymore.
[0001-gnu-system-Symlink-guix-inside-an-initial-guix-pull-.patch (application/octet-stream, attachment)]

This bug report was last modified 2 years and 355 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.